The Week in Review: SFDA Releases 2010 Approval Data

October 22, 2011 -- The SFDA released a summary of its 2010 decisions, showing 1,000 drug approvals, 916 clinical trial approvals, and 6,294 requests for drug approvals; Zhuhai Hokai Medical Instruments raised $104.5 million in an IPO on the ChiNext Exchange; Simcere Pharma and Suzhou NeuPharma will collaborate to develop novel drugs; Amerigen Pharma partnered with Stason Pharma to develop generic oral oncology drugs; Lundbeck A/S, a Danish CNS drugmaker, established a research center in Shanghai; Medicilon will complete the pre-clinical development of SK Biopharma’s new anti-depressant; Samantha Du quietly stepped back from her duties as CEO of Hutchison MediPharma; and Shenzhen Hepalink Pharma reported its Q3 profits fell 58% because of a drop in heparin prices.
